build system: allow assigning files to regions
Using the regions-for-file function, the build system can now declare which (CBFS formatted) fmap region(s) a file should end up in. The default is to put them in the regular COREBOOT region, but more complex boot schemes (eg. vboot or fallback/normal) can use the function to implement suitable policies.
